The Forum for Democratic Change flag bearer in the coming Rukungiri district woman Member of Parliament seat by election, Betty Bamukwatsa Muzanira has said that she would not hesitate to go back to court if her victory was rigged again on 31st May, 2018.
Muzanira said this on Monday while campaigning in Buhunga Sub County.
“I know I must win, what is remaining now is to lay a strategy of protecting my votes. Your vote counts, watch out!” she said.
“My supporters in 2016 requested me to go to court after their victory was taken away. Court has given us another chance and we should use it well knowing that we shall not go back to court”
Muzanira said that there is a lot of intimidation in the whole district, adding that some of her supporters are already in prison for unknown reasons.
“You’re now the final Judges, you have to vote in big numbers as you have come today, keep at the polling station, count the vote and get representatives who will escort the results to the district until we are declared winners that’s when you will go back home to celebrate,” she said.
Betty Bamukwatsa Muzanira was accompanied by Rukungiri Municipality MP, Rolland Mugume Kaginda, Buhweju MP, Francis Mwijukye and FDCs national secretary for mobilization Ingrid Turinawe among the others.
